Before explaining the reason for our disappointment, let's take a look at the year-end results, compared to our existing forecast. The following chart shows that the estimated total of h-s lines continues to run ahead of our forecast, and even is increasing its lead over the forecast.

B&C Consulting estimates (although larger providers are tracked, the quantity of smaller providers make it necessary to estimate totals) indicate that the year finished with 21,069,000 h-s accesses in service. That is almost exactly 20% of the households in the US with h-s access. This mark has been reached faster than almost any other residential communication or entertainment technology!
